XRP is the native asset of the XRP Ledger, a public blockchain designed with fast settlement and low transaction costs in mind. It is often discussed in the context of payments because the network can move value quickly compared with many traditional rails. That speed is a technical feature, not a promise about price performance.
The XRP Ledger uses a consensus process that differs from proof-of-work mining. Validators help agree on the state of the ledger, and transactions can settle without the energy-intensive mining model used by Bitcoin. This design is one reason the network is frequently mentioned in conversations about payment infrastructure.
A common source of confusion is the relationship between XRP the asset, the XRP Ledger the network, and Ripple the company. Ripple builds products that may use XRP or interact with the XRP Ledger, but the public ledger itself is broader than one company. Readers should separate the technology from any single business narrative.
The strongest educational question is not simply whether XRP is popular. Better questions include how the ledger is used, what liquidity exists for the asset, how validators are distributed, and what regulatory or business dependencies may affect adoption. Those questions create a fuller picture than a headline can.
XRP can be part of serious infrastructure discussions and still carry market risk. Crypto prices can react to news, liquidity, legal developments, and broader market cycles. Understanding the ledger does not remove the need for caution.

A practical habit is to write down the claim being tested. If the claim is about safety, look for audits, permissions, custody controls, and incident history. If it is about adoption, look for usage, retention, integrations, and active development. If it is about price, remember that this article does not provide trading advice.
Readers should also compare sources instead of relying on one page, chart, or social thread. Official documentation can explain intended design, block explorers can confirm on-chain facts, community channels can show participation, and independent reporting can reveal concerns that marketing pages avoid. When those sources disagree, the disagreement itself is useful information.
